The Extensive Technique of Administering IQ Tests to Small children

IQ testing for children represents a sophisticated psychological evaluation that goes considerably further than simple dilemma-and-answer classes. Your complete system starts with mindful preparation, where capable psychologists or properly trained examiners make an ideal testing environment designed to elicit a Kid's greatest cognitive efficiency while protecting rigorous standardization protocols.

The physical tests setting plays an important part in exact evaluation. Examiners ensure the place is effectively-lit, temperature-managed, and cost-free from distractions for instance noise, Visible clutter, or interruptions. The home furnishings is appropriately sized for youngsters, and testing products are arranged systematically to take care of easy administration. This notice to environmental specifics helps lessen external variables that could artificially inflate or deflate a child's performance.

Ahead of commencing the formal assessment, examiners expend time creating rapport with the kid. This partnership-constructing section is crucial for the reason that anxious or unpleasant youngsters might not display their legitimate cognitive qualities. Skilled examiners use age-appropriate conversation, gentle encouragement, and occasionally brief warm-up activities to assist kids really feel at ease. They also explain the procedure in very simple conditions, generally describing the jobs as "video games" or "puzzles" to cut back efficiency anxiousness.

The particular tests approach generally spans two to four several hours, nevertheless this differs drastically depending on the child's age, notice span, and the particular check becoming administered. Young little ones typically need shorter classes with far more Regular breaks, while more mature kids can typically maintain interest for for a longer period intervals. Examiners cautiously observe signs of exhaustion, stress, or loss of drive, as these aspects can significantly affect outcomes.

All through administration, examiners stick to demanding protocols with regards to timing, presentation of materials, and recording of responses. They Notice not only no matter if answers are proper but also observe trouble-solving approaches, persistence in the experience of issue, and the child's approach to differing kinds of tasks. These qualitative observations supply precious context for interpreting the quantitative scores.

Choosing the Appropriate Experienced: The Importance of Medical Psychologists with Neuropsychological Abilities

When seeking IQ testing for kids, picking out the right Expert is critical for acquiring exact, significant results. Clinical psychologists with specialized instruction in neuropsychological evaluation characterize the gold conventional for conducting these evaluations. These experts possess the Superior skills needed to thoroughly administer, rating, and interpret complex cognitive assessments while comprehending the intricate connection amongst brain perform and behavior.

Medical psychologists with neuropsychological education have concluded intensive education and learning outside of their doctoral diploma, which includes specialized coursework in Mind-behavior interactions, neuroanatomy, and cognitive assessment. Several have also accomplished postdoctoral fellowships precisely focused on neuropsychological evaluation, delivering them with fingers-on expertise in administering and interpreting refined cognitive tests under qualified supervision.

This specialised education allows these experts to acknowledge refined styles in take a look at functionality That may indicate fundamental Finding out distinctions, interest difficulties, or other cognitive variants that might influence a Kid's academic requirements. They could distinguish between momentary functionality variables and much more persistent cognitive styles, making sure that take a look at effects correctly reflect a Kid's legitimate talents in lieu of situational influences.

Also, clinical psychologists with neuropsychological abilities are uniquely capable to detect when more assessment could be warranted. If IQ testing reveals sudden styles or discrepancies, these industry experts can establish no matter whether more analysis for Mastering disabilities, attention Problems, or other neurological circumstances would be useful. This extensive perspective makes sure that families get total specifics of their child's cognitive profile and any components that might affect academic functionality.

The detailed studies created by these specialists transcend simple score reporting to deliver meaningful interpretation of effects within the context of child progress and educational arranging. They might describe how precise cognitive strengths and challenges may possibly manifest in classroom configurations and recommend proper academic lodging or interventions when desired.

Official IQ Exams: The Wechsler Household and Outside of

The Wechsler Intelligence Scales dominate the landscape of Formal pediatric IQ testing, with various versions made for distinct age ranges and applications. The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for youngsters, Fifth Version (WISC-V) serves as the primary assessment Instrument for college-aged young children from six to sixteen yrs aged. This comprehensive battery evaluates 5 primary index scores that together contribute to a Full Scale IQ score.

The WISC-V's Verbal Comprehension Index measures crystallized intelligence through subtests like Vocabulary, exactly where kids define phrases of growing problems, and Similarities, which needs figuring out relationships concerning principles. The Visible Spatial Index assesses the chance to Assess visual details and understand spatial interactions as a result of responsibilities like Block Style and design, the place young children recreate patterns utilizing coloured cubes, and Visible Puzzles, which include mentally rotating and manipulating objects.

The Fluid Reasoning Index evaluates the capacity to unravel novel challenges by way of subtests including Matrix Reasoning, exactly where children detect designs and logical interactions, and Figure Weights, which requires being familiar with quantitative associations. The Functioning Memory Index steps the opportunity to temporarily keep and manipulate details through Digit Span and film Span tasks. At last, the Processing Pace Index assesses the velocity and accuracy of cognitive processing through Symbol Search and Coding subtests.

For youthful children aged two many years six months via seven years seven months, the Wechsler Preschool and first Scale of Intelligence, Fourth Edition (WPPSI-IV) presents developmentally proper evaluation. This version incorporates far more manipulative and Participate in-primarily based pursuits though sustaining demanding psychometric criteria. The exam structure varies by age, with more youthful little ones acquiring much less subtests to accommodate shorter interest spans.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Edition (SB-5) delivers an alternate detailed evaluation acceptable for people aged two through 85 many years. This check is particularly useful for evaluating young children with Fantastic qualities or developmental delays because of its prolonged vary and adaptive tests structure. The SB-five evaluates 5 cognitive variables: Fluid Reasoning, Expertise, Quantitative Reasoning, Visual-Spatial Processing, and Working Memory, Each and every assessed by means of the two verbal and nonverbal modalities.

Further specialized assessments consist of the Kaufman Assessment Battery for Children, Second Edition (KABC-II), which emphasizes processing skills more than click here acquired awareness, rendering it significantly practical for youngsters from numerous cultural backgrounds or Those people with language challenges. The Cognitive Evaluation Technique, 2nd Edition (CAS-two) relies on neuropsychological theory and evaluates planning, notice, simultaneous processing, and successive processing talents.

The Increasing Pattern: Why Non-public Schools Mandate IQ Tests

Personal elementary colleges' increasing reliance on IQ screening for admissions reflects various converging components in modern education. These establishments encounter rigorous Levels of competition for enrollment, usually acquiring apps that far exceed readily available positions. In main metropolitan areas, prestigious personal schools may well receive 10 or more purposes For each and every offered kindergarten location, necessitating systematic procedures for distinguishing amid certified candidates.

Academic compatibility signifies the primary commitment driving IQ testing demands. Personal educational facilities, specially All those with accelerated curricula or specialized packages, have to have assurance that incoming college students can tackle rigorous coursework without having experiencing tutorial failure or psychological distress. Schools providing Global Baccalaureate programs, classical education and learning designs, or STEM-centered curricula have to have college students with distinct cognitive strengths to reach these demanding environments.

The selectivity arms race among the private colleges has intensified as dad and mom significantly perspective early educational placement as essential for extended-phrase educational and Specialist results. Educational facilities use IQ scores as aim steps that can not be affected by tutoring, coaching, or socioeconomic pros in a similar way that accomplishment checks or portfolios is likely to be. This perceived objectivity appeals to admissions committees seeking good and defensible range conditions.

Economical criteria also push IQ screening demands. Personal colleges make investments substantial resources in compact course measurements, specialized programs, and individualized notice. They will need self esteem that admitted pupils will take advantage of these investments and contribute positively to The varsity Local community. College students who wrestle academically may well demand extra support expert services that strain institutional resources and likely affect the educational working experience of other pupils.

Numerous non-public educational institutions use IQ testing to establish college students who'd thrive of their certain instructional philosophy or pedagogical strategy. Schools emphasizing Artistic arts may well look for college kids with powerful Visible-spatial abilities, when These specializing in classical languages and literature may prioritize verbal reasoning techniques. This targeted assortment helps educational institutions maintain their unique character and academic focus.

The rise of gifted education schemes within personal educational facilities has additional greater demand for IQ testing. These packages ordinarily need pupils to attain in the best 2-5% in the populace, similar to IQ scores of 130 or larger. Universities featuring gifted tracks use these assessments to make sure proper educational placement and prevent the issues associated with academically mismatched students.

Specialized Assessments and Cultural Factors

Present day IQ screening has advanced to handle problems about cultural bias and numerous Discovering styles. The Common Nonverbal Intelligence Test (Device-two) eradicates language prerequisites solely, rendering it well suited for children with Listening to impairments, language delays, or confined English proficiency. In the same way, the Take a look at of Nonverbal Intelligence, Fourth Version (TONI-4) makes use of only pointing and gesturing responses, getting rid of verbal and composed language barriers.

Some private schools precisely request these alternate assessments when assessing college students from numerous backgrounds or All those with Finding out variances. These faculties understand that traditional verbal-major assessments might not precisely reflect the cognitive talents of all young children, specifically those whose to start with language will not be English or that have specific Discovering disabilities impacting language processing.

Implications for Parents and academic Preparing

Parents navigating the personal school admissions course of action must recognize that IQ screening provides worthwhile info extending considerably past faculty variety. The in-depth cognitive profile generated by detailed assessments can tell academic decisions through a Kid's academic job, assisting establish optimal Finding out strategies, prospective parts of problems, and chances for enrichment.

The timing of IQ tests can considerably affect results and should be thoroughly considered. Youngsters suffering from major existence improvements, health issues, or emotional tension might not complete at their usual level. Similarly, really younger children's scores can be fewer stable and predictive than These of older youngsters, as cognitive capabilities continue on producing fast during early childhood.

Comprehending score interpretation assists mother and father sustain acceptable expectations and make knowledgeable choices. IQ scores symbolize existing cognitive working as opposed to set intellectual capacity or future accomplishment probable. Components for instance enthusiasm, creativeness, social expertise, and emotional intelligence add appreciably to educational and existence good results but aren't captured by traditional IQ assessments.

Parents also needs to identify that faculties utilizing IQ tests for admissions generally use holistic analysis procedures that think about multiple components. Although cognitive capability may very well be needed for admission to particular courses, it isn't ample by by itself. Schools also Appraise social maturity, behavioral aspects, family healthy with school lifestyle, and possible contributions to The varsity community.

The financial investment in Skilled IQ tests can provide Long lasting benefits over and above faculty admissions. The in depth report created by certified psychologists presents insights into Studying strengths and troubles that may information instructional organizing, tutoring selections, and accommodation needs during a Kid's tutorial career. This data results in being specifically precious if learning troubles emerge later on, as it offers baseline data for comparison and evaluation.

When carried out by medical psychologists with neuropsychological abilities, IQ tests gets to be a comprehensive evaluation that extends significantly outside of very simple rating generation. These experts can recognize delicate cognitive designs, propose correct instructional interventions, and supply people with actionable insights that support their child's lengthy-term academic good results and All round growth.
